Rulon Bearings

LATI LAXTAR G/30 30% Glass Reinforced LCP  (discontinued **)
Categories: Polymer; Thermoplastic; Liquid Crystal Polymer (LCP); Liquid Crystal Polymer (LCP), 30% Glass Fiber Filled

Material Notes: Description: Laxtar products are liquid crystal polymers (LCP). They offer exceptional performance together with increasing cost-effectiveness. Due to the outstanding fluidity at high shear rates LCPs can be injection-molded into long thin-wall components (as thin as 0.25 millimeter) at high speeds and by using very short cycle times. Moreover the thermal stability of Laxtar allows efficient use of high percentage of regrind. Laxtar meets the requirements of vapor phase and infrared soldering for surface mount assembly technology . Moreover they withstand high levels of UV radiation and are transparent to microwaves.

Specific Notes for this Material: LCP, 30% glass fiber, flame retardant UL94 V0, halogens and red phosphorous free

Physical PropertiesMetricEnglishComments
Density 1.60 g/cc0.0578 lb/in³ISO 1183
Linear Mold Shrinkage 0.0020 cm/cm0.0020 in/inLATI
Linear Mold Shrinkage, Transverse 0.0050 cm/cm0.0050 in/inLATI
 
Mechanical PropertiesMetricEnglishComments
Tensile Strength, Ultimate 130 MPa18900 psiISO 527
Flexural Modulus 14.0 GPa2030 ksiASTM D790
Izod Impact, Notched 0.900 J/cm
@Temperature 23.0 °C
1.69 ft-lb/in
@Temperature 73.4 °F
ASTM D256
 
Electrical PropertiesMetricEnglishComments
Dielectric Strength 38.0 kV/mm
@Thickness 2.00 mm
965 kV/in
@Thickness 0.0787 in
IEC 243-1
Comparative Tracking Index 185 V185 VIEC 112
 
Thermal PropertiesMetricEnglishComments
Deflection Temperature at 1.8 MPa (264 psi) 270 °C518 °FASTM D648
Flammability, UL94  V-0
@Thickness 0.750 mm
V-0
@Thickness 0.0295 in
 V-0
@Thickness 1.50 mm
V-0
@Thickness 0.0591 in
 
Processing PropertiesMetricEnglishComments
Melt Temperature 320 - 360 °C608 - 680 °F
Mold Temperature 65.0 - 95.0 °C149 - 203 °F
Drying Temperature 150 °C302 °FUse a desiccant-type hopper dryer. For tray drying, pellets should be dried in 2.5-5 mm deep layer for 8 hours.
Dry Time 6 - 8 hour6 - 8 hour
 
Descriptive Properties
Injection Speedhigh
